如何使用Visual Studio 2012生成测试数据?

时间:2012-09-26 22:28:38

标签: sql-server-2008 visual-studio-2012

如何使用Visual Studio 2012生成测试数据?

我发现了这两篇关于如何使用VS 2010的文章。但是VS 2012呢?

我的数据库是SQL-Server 2008-R2数据库。

提前致谢。

3 个答案:

答案 0 :(得分:6)

虽然此功能在Visual Studio 2010中(如果您添加了VSTE DBPRO),但它did not make the cut for Visual Studio 2012 / SSDT(尚未)。这并不意味着它不会在下一个版本之前进入产品 - 它可以作为功能包,power tool或甚至在服务包中。 Same with database unit testing and data compare functionality

正如我在评论中建议的那样,在此期间您可以使用第三方工具,例如RedGate's SQL Data Generator。另请参阅this question了解其他一些选项。并挂在那里。 : - )

答案 1 :(得分:0)

VS 2012中根本不支持数据库单元测试。

答案 2 :(得分:0)

从现在开始,我们需要依赖第三方工具,因为Microsoft将来不会支持此功能。  http://blogs.msdn.com/b/ssdt/archive/2013/06/24/announcing-sql-server-data-tools-june-2013.aspx 搜索“未包含数据生成且未计划在未来发布”

如果我们使用测试驱动开发,那就没什么大不了的。在TDD中,我们将有组件测试触摸数据库(完整场景覆盖)。我们可以使用相同的模块来创建测试数据。